Output 18abb73b594d5abcdee705c35e506b7040ce8f8069d6e63f87b65ce2da59020e: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958a9e3cdb67896fb2b42e7e22541c808f7198f7 OP_EQUAL
address
3FKifUuqtvh9p1oJxVEA1VbjZLEQCTi3tp
transaction
18abb73b594d5abcdee705c35e506b7040ce8f8069d6e63f87b65ce2da59020e
spent
true